About The Position

Robertson Media Center Consultants are held to the highest standards of customer service. Potential employees with a foundation of knowledge about basic computer hardware and specialized video, audio, 3D, Virtual Reality and/or Augmented Reality will be given preference. Previous experience in customer service is greatly appreciated. Our patron use is currently heavily video and audio creation based, so expertise in the Adobe Creative Suite, Logic Pro, Final Cut Pro, Garageband, Audacity, and/or similar software is appreciated. Willingness to learn hardware and software, including 3D printing, VR, and 3D modeling/animation software is preferred. Consultants are responsible for checking out multi-piece equipment to patrons, consulting with faculty, staff, and students about what equipment and software will best complete their projects, alongside supporting them in the use of said software and equipment. We have several specialized spaces for media creation and consultants will also need to be familiar with these areas to assist patrons as needed. Please note that this position is not your average library student position and our hourly rate is commensurate with for the diligence, professionalism, and hard work we expect from our consultants. On average consultants receive 7-10 assigned hours per week and we work with a system where co-workers will drop their shifts and you can augment your assigned hours by picking up those shifts. Shifts are usually 2 hour blocks where you, and at times a co-worker, are responsible for greeting, consulting with and aiding patrons that approach one our desks. While you are not expected to know everything about each piece of equipment, space, or software, you should have a well-rounded base of knowledge and be familiar enough with the landscape of our library to know where to get the assistance needed. The core components of the job are great customer service, a natural ambition to learn & follow instructions, and knowing how to effectively Google search.
